An Act To designate the facility of the United States Postal Service located at 4755 Southeast Dixie Highway in Port Salerno, Florida, as the “Joseph Bullock Post Office Building”.Jan. 5, 2021[[H.R. 8611](/us/bill/116/hr/8611)] *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representa­tives of the United States of America in Congress assembled,* ## SECTION 1 JOSEPH BULLOCK POST OFFICE BUILDING ###
(a)Designation The facility of the United States Postal Service located at 4755 Southeast Dixie Highway in Port Salerno, Florida, shall be known and designated as the “Joseph Bullock Post Office Building”. ###
(b)References Any reference in a law, map, regulation, document, paper, or other record of the United States to the facility referred to in subsection
(a)shall be deemed to be a reference to the “Joseph Bullock Post Office Building”. Approved January 5, 2021.
